How Often Should HVAC System Cleaning Be Scheduled?
For most Breckenridge Hills homeowners, scheduling HVAC system cleaning twice a year is ideal. This typically means a check-up in the spring, before the summer heat sets in, and another in the fall, before the winter chill arrives. However, there are specific considerations unique to Breckenridge Hills that may necessitate more frequent cleaning:
- High pollen levels in spring: Increased pollen can clog filters and ducts, affecting air quality.
- Proximity to highways and urban areas: Additional dust and pollutants can infiltrate HVAC systems more quickly.
Signs Your HVAC System Needs Cleaning
Your HVAC system will often provide signs that cleaning is overdue. Be on the lookout for:
- Increase in energy bills
- Unusual noises from the system
- Reduced airflow from vents
- Frequent allergies or respiratory issues in household members
- Visible dust accumulations around air vents
If you notice any of these issues, schedule an HVAC system cleaning promptly.

Common Mistakes to Avoid in HVAC Maintenance
Breckenridge Hills residents can sometimes overlook certain aspects of HVAC maintenance. Avoid these common pitfalls:
- Neglecting filter changes: Filters should be replaced every 1-3 months, particularly during peak seasons.
- Skipping annual inspections: Even if the system seems fine, yearly professional inspections can catch potential issues early.
- DIY cleaning without proper knowledge: Complex components should always be handled by professionals to avoid damage.
By steering clear of these errors, you ensure your HVAC system operates at its best, providing comfort and safety for your family.
